gotta say i agree with bob on this

the old KING OF THE HILL was fun to play at times, but very unrealistic poker,and to be honest going from playing there to a cash game was often suicidal.

most of the time it was flip a coin, cause a normal 3 or 4X BB raise was pointless if holding a decent hand, cause you'd get 6 or 8 callers, or even re-raised by some1 holding any 2 suited cards, or o/s connectors.

which takes alot of the stratagy out the play, more who gets lucky

ok dont get me wrong, free poker should be fun, but if your wanting to play,learn amd improve your game, then i always found the rings was more about having a laugh more than serious poker.
